Extradiction orders are not letters, they are valid orders from the court of the originating country and yes, if two countries have an extradiction treaty signed and passed into law by both country's legislatives, that order is as good as having been issued by a judge in the destination country.

The US and Nigeria signed an extradiction treaty, that treaty was ratified and passed into law by the Nigeria Senate and it has the same force of law as any other bill or law passed by the Nigeria Senate and NDLEA is bounded to carry out that order.

Only that, they have to arrest him, take him to a court in Nigeria for extradiction hearing. Such hearings have a limited scope, it is not evidentiary, which means you cannot plead your case there...they will look up want he is being charged with, compare it to see if such charges are also illegal in Nigeria, some countries with lots of influences also ensure that, their treaty also provides that intended punishment shall not be such that are illegal in their home countries....eg if the punishment for his crime is the death penalty and hypothetically Nigeria does not support the death penalty, the extradiction judge will refuse to allow him to be extradited until the other country agree not to seek the death penalty, the judge also look to make such that, none of his rights will be violated,etc...after which he will be handed over.
